Transaction faaba0c3593f34458f4e0b684c92dac62075a54fc81f339d2757bf6ce8e869e5
1 Input
1 Outputs
- faaba0c3593f34458f4e0b684c92dac62075a54fc81f339d2757bf6ce8e869e5:0
value 592996
address 1NgbBNHud29HaUEHuJCNxJD5gg89h92qoe